Proving Negligence

Each year, children are born with injuries from birth that are preventable. These injuries are often caused by medical errors and inattention from doctors as well as other health care professionals. These mistakes can result in permanent disability as well as financial burdens for families. You and your child can be awarded damages through a lawsuit.

Your lawyer will establish the following elements when seeking compensation in a medical malpractice case:

Duty of Care

The defendant must have had a legal duty to you or your child to provide high-quality medical care. This is typically determined by examining the care that could be provided in similar circumstances or by examining what a qualified healthcare professional would have done.

Breach of Duty

You must prove that the defendant's failure to follow the standard treatment caused your child's injury. This is typically done through expert testimony and other evidence.

Causation

Once it is determined that the doctor breached their duty of care, it has to be established that the failure caused your child's injury. This is known as finding causation. It can be difficult to link a specific act or omission with an injury, but your lawyer can make use of medical experts and other evidence sources to build a strong case for you.

Damages

You must prove that the birth injury of your child has caused economic and noneconomic damages to be qualified for settlement. Medical bills and medical records as well as photographs of the injuries are commonly used to demonstrate this. Your attorney can help you determine the total amount you are entitled to in damages by formulating the estimated lifetime costs of the care of your child.

Establishing Damages

If a medical error during birth results in an injury that is permanent to your child, you may need to seek compensation. Your attorney can assist you in establishing a claim to seek damages for your family's past and future losses. They will look over your medical documents and work with experts to establish the medical standard of care, breach of this standard, causation and damages.

Medical negligence claims are based on evidence, including detailed medical records linking the care provided to your child's injuries. Other evidence includes expert witness testimony as well as hospital records and policies, eyewitnesses' statements, and video evidence. The attorneys can also help you gather documents that pertain to your pregnancy, doctor's visits, and medical procedures.

A medical standard of care is a set of guidelines that is deemed acceptable by experts in the field, typically other doctors. Your lawyer will employ experts to look over the medical records of your child and give a formal opinion on whether the doctor in question adhered to this standard in the circumstances of your case. They will also determine if the doctor's actions were in violation of this standard and whether that was the direct cause of the oklahoma city birth injury attorney injury suffered by your child.

In determining the amount of damages you can claim it is important to take into account all your present, past, and future medical expenses related to your child's injuries. Additionally, you must take into consideration the loss of quality as well as other non-economic damage. This can be assessed with the Life Care Plan. This is a plan that was developed with the assistance of financial and medical experts to assess your child's needs throughout their lifetime.

After hiring a legal firm the lawyer you choose will request copies of all relevant medical records. He or she will then look over the records and find evidence of medical malpractice. This may involve the involvement of other physicians to discuss the matter and give their opinion as to whether the medical professionals have violated the standards of care.

Your legal team will create a demand letter that explains the harm done to your child and also how much you think their injuries are worth in terms of damages. A demand letter is intended to get the defendants attention and encourage them to settle out of court.

If the defendants do not agree to settle, your lawyer will prepare for trial by requesting expert witnesses and depositions. Your lawyer will use information gathered during discovery to win an appeal to a verdict by the jury or negotiate a fair settlement. Filing an action

After analyzing and gathering the evidence Your lawyer will assist you determine the amount of damages you should seek. They will work with financial and medical experts to determine what types and amounts you'll require in light of the present and future requirements of your child. This includes the cost of therapy and medical treatments as well as your family's emotional stress and loss.

Then your attorney will file a lawsuit against the doctor or hospital responsible for the birth injury of your child. Depending on the case, multiple defendants may be named. These could include the doctor who delivered your child, nurses who assisted during delivery and the hospital in which the birth occurred. The defendants will receive an Order and Complaint and will have the option of filing an Answer. The parties will then undergo an investigation where they exchange information and evidence including testimony of witnesses, medical records and other documents. This will also include hearings and meetings in which both sides will argue their case before a jury or judge.
